body,div,form,p,ul,ol,li,h1,h2,h3,h4,h5,h6{margin:0px 0px;}
body{
	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size:14px;
	background:#E28A7C url(../cmsimages/body_bg.jpg) repeat-x left top;
	color:#333333;
}
table{border:none;}
td{vertical-align:top;}
img{border:none}
p{color: #333333;
	line-height:18px;
	padding: 0px 0px 10px;}

a{
	color: #333333;
	text-decoration:none;
}

a:active, a:hover{}

h1{
	font-size: 24px;
	line-height:30px;
	font-weight:normal;	
}
h2{
	font-size: 22px;
	line-height:24px;
	font-weight:bold;
	color:#605E5D;
	padding: 0px 0px 10px;
}
h3{
	font-size: 18px;
	font-weight:bold;	
	padding: 0px 0px 10px;
}
h4{
	font-size: 16px;
	font-weight:bold;
	padding: 0px 0px 10px;
}
h5{
	font-size: 14px;
	font-weight:bold;
}
h6{
	font-size: 14px;
	font-weight:normal;
	font-style:italic;
	line-height:26px;
	text-align:right;
}
h6 a{color:#B62125;
	text-decoration:underline;}
ol,ul{padding: 0px 0px 10px 20px;}
li{padding-bottom:5px;}


.redText{color:#B62125;}
.whiteText{color:#FFF;}
.lgtGrayText{color:#605E5D;}
.grayText{color:#333;}
.blackText{color:#000;}
.pageLink{color: #B62125;text-decoration:underline;}

.smallerFont{font-size:80%;}
.smallFont{font-size:90%;}
.largerFont{font-size:110%;}
.xlargeFont{font-size:150%;}

.arialFont{font-family:Arial, Helvetica, sans-serif;}
.georgiaFont{font-family:Georgia, "Times New Roman", Times, serif;
	letter-spacing:0.03cm;}
	
#page{
	width:1024px;
	margin:0px auto;
	position:relative;
	background-color:#FFF;
	border-bottom:10px solid #FFF;
}
#wrapper{padding: 22px 11px 50px 13px;
	background:transparent url(../cmsimages/watermark.jpg) no-repeat 11px bottom;
	width:1002px;

	}

#logo{padding: 0px 0px 16px 32px;}

#navMenu{width:1002px;z-index:10}
ul.navtop, .navtop li{list-style:none;float:left;margin:0px 0px;}
ul.navtop{padding:0px 0px;width:1002px;}
.navtop li{
	padding: 15px 0px 0px;
	width:111px;
	vertical-align:middle;
	color: #FFFFFF;
	background:transparent url(../cmsimages/nav_off.jpg) no-repeat left bottom;
	}
.navtop li.first{background:transparent url(../cmsimages/nav_off_home.jpg) no-repeat left bottom;}
.navtop a{
	display:block;
	font-size:13px;
	text-transform:capitalize;
	color: #FFFFFF;
	text-align:center;
	padding:15px 0px 5px;
	}
.navtop li.first.selected, .navtop li.first:hover{background:transparent url(../cmsimages/nav_on_home.jpg) no-repeat left bottom;}
	
.navtop li.selected a, .navtop li:hover a{	}
.navtop li.selected, .navtop li:hover{
	width:111px;
	color: #fff;
	padding: 15px 0px 0px;
	vertical-align:middle;
	background:transparent url(../cmsimages/nav_on.jpg) no-repeat left bottom;}

.navtop ul{
	display:none;
	position:absolute;
	width:auto;
	height:1%;
}
	
.navtop li:hover ul, .navtop li:hover ul:hover, .navtop ul:hover{
	display:block;
	background-color:#B62125;
	width:190px;
	padding:10px 0px 5px;
	position:absolute;
	height:auto;
	margin-left:-79px;
	z-index:100;
}
.navtop li:hover li,.navtop li:hover li.first{
	background:transparent none;
	padding:0px 0px;
	clear:left;
	line-height:13px;
	vertical-align:top;
	line-height:normal;
	width:180px;	
	padding:0px 0px 10px 10px;
	}
.navtop li:hover li.last{background:transparent none;}
.navtop li:hover li:hover{}
.navtop li:hover ul a, .navtop li:hover ul a{
	display:inline;
	color:#fff;
	font-size:12px;
	line-height:13px;
	text-transform:lowercase;
	white-space:normal;
	text-transform:capitalize;
	text-align:left;
	padding: 0px;
	width:auto;}

#crumbtrail{position:absolute;
	left:51px;
	top:272px;
	color:#B62125;font-weight:bold;font-size:13px;
	z-index:1;}

#crumbtrail a{color:#B62125;font-weight:bold;font-size:13px;padding-right:15px;background:transparent url(../cmsimages/crumb.gif) no-repeat right center;}

#content{float:left;
	width:628px;}
#content_2{
	background-color:#4F4C4C;
	height:230px;
	width:276px;
	padding: 40px 65px 10px 30px;
	}
#content_3{width:206px;
	height:auto;
	margin: 50px 0px 0px 150px;
	float:left;}
#content_3 a{color:#B62125;}	
#content_3 a:hover{text-decoration:underline;}

#content_4{width:575px;
	margin: 50px 0px 20px 400px;
	position:relative;}
	
#content_5{background-color:#444243;
	border-bottom:1px solid #A2A0A1;
	width:524px;
	height:65px;
	padding: 30px 20px 0px 41px;
	text-transform:uppercase;}
#content_5 h1{font-family:Georgia, "Times New Roman", Times, serif;
	font-size:18px;
	line-height:30px;
	letter-spacing:0.10cm;}

/*Sub Page Content */

#globalcontent_4{position:absolute;
	right:102px;
	border-top:1px solid #FFFFFF;
	border-bottom: 1px solid #FFFFFF;
	border-left:2px solid #FFFFFF;
	border-right:2px solid FFFFFF;
	width:143px;
	height:20px;
	padding-top:2px;
	line-height:20px;
	vertical-align:middle;
}

#globalcontent_4 input{
	border:none;
	background-color:transparent;
	margin: 0px 0px;
	padding: 2px 0px 0px 8px;
	width:117px;
	color:#BDBEC0;
	font-size:12px;
	line-height:13px;
	height:14px;
	vertical-align:top;
	font-family:Arial, Helvetica, sans-serif;}
	
#content_8{
	width:200px;
	height:auto;
	margin:76px 0px 20px 25px;
	float:left;}
#content_8 a{color:#B62125;}	
#content_8 a:hover{text-decoration:underline;}

#content_7{width:490px;
	margin: 45px 0px 20px 275px;
	min-height:350px;}
	
#content_7 h1{padding-bottom:10px;
line-height:30px;}
#borders{
	border:1px #BDBEC0 solid;
	position:absolute;
	right:22px;
	top:349px;
	width:198px;
}
	
#content_9{
	background-color:#E6E7E9;
	border: 1px #C7C8CC solid;
	width:176px;
	min-height:120px;
	padding: 15px 10px;
	font-size:12px;
	line-height:14px;}

#content_9 ul{list-style:none;padding: 0px 0px 0px;}
#content_9 ul a{color:#B62125;
	text-decoration:underline;
	font-size:12px;}
#content_9 p{padding-bottom:5px;}

#globalcontent{position:absolute;
	margin-left:400px;
	bottom:0px;
	color: #B62125;
	font-size:11px;
}
#globalcontent_5{position:absolute;
	margin-left:280px;
	bottom: 0px;
	color: #B62125;
	font-size:11px;
	}	

/* LogoWorks Style Sheet */
#logoworks, #logoworks a{
	font-size:10px;
	line-height:11px;
	color: #B62125;
	font-weight:normal;
	text-decoration:none;
}